Note: The 37% surcharge applies only under the old regime and not under the new regime. Additional Points: The surcharge is calculated on the income tax amount, not the total income.; Marginal relief is available to prevent excessive tax burden due to a small increase in income.; The Health & Education Cess (4%) is levied on the total tax (including surcharge) in both regimes.

A surcharge is basically a tax on income tax. The government levies it on the tax payable (not on your income). So, before filing your ITR for a financial year, you must calculate the surcharge on your income tax. Marginal relief ensures that a small increase in your income does not increase your income taxes by a wide margin.

The surcharge is calculated as a percentage of the total income tax liability before applying cess (additional tax). The Health and Education Cess, currently at 4%, is then applied on the sum of the income tax and surcharge. Example Calculation of Surcharge on Income Tax.
